Construction sites in Melbourne Florida and throughout Florida contain potential risks. According to the Bureau of Labor Statistics, There were a total of 5,147 fatal work injuries reported in the United States in 2017, down slightly from the 5,190 deadly injuries documented in 2016. Out of 4,693 workforce deaths in private industry in calendar yr 2016, 991 or 21.1% were in construction-- that is, one in five employee fatalities last year were in construction. The primary causes of private industry worker fatalities (leaving out highway collisions) in the construction industry were falls, followed by struck by object, electrocution, and caught-in/between. Due to the increased hazard of personal injury in the construction field, the Occupational Health and Safety Administration (OSHA) has tight policies regulating workplace safety, many of which deal with construction sites. Numbers of fatalities were obtained from the Census of Fatal Occupational Injuries (CFOI) conducted by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S).

Securing Critical Accident Scene Evidence
An investigation entails an examination of the scene and the evidence can involve construction materials and gear, together with the scene of the accident itself. In many instances, it is necessary to obtain court orders to conserve evidence. Investigative authorities, for example, the Occupational Safety and Health Administration, should be notified of the accident. It is equally essential for any sort of construction accident case that there is a quick investigation of all general contractors and subcontractors, material suppliers, as well as potential witnesses. These elements must be handled as soon as possible following an injury, before the evidence, "fades".

There are numerous parties that may be held liable following a construction personal injury, not just an employer.
These can include the following and more:
- Contractors
- Subcontractors
- Appliances manufacturers
- Semi operators Accidents
- Architects
- Residential property owners
- Insurance Companies
The Florida Statute of Limitations applies to construction accident suits, which means injured parties have a limited time in which to file their lawsuit. A newly developed database allowed analysts to establish that, in a 33-year time span, falls represented close to one-half of all construction worker deaths-- and more than half of the workers killed lacked easy access to fall protection-- according to the Center for Construction Research and Training (also referred to as CPWR).
